2016-06-25 2 views

답변

10

http://reactivex.io/rxjs/manual/overview.html을 읽을 때 동일한 질문이있었습니다. 그래서 .publish().multicast(new Rx.Subject()) 단지 속기, 그것은 명확하게 (그리고 publishBehavior, publishLastpublishReplay은 비슷하지만 각각 BehaviorSubject, AsyncSubjectReplaySubject의 인스턴스)입니다.

3

그들은 실제로 매우 유사하며 훨씬 더 혼란스러운 역사를 가지고 있습니다.

간단히 말하자면 게시는 멀티 캐스트의 특별한 경우입니다. 게시는 항상 새로운 주제를 만들고 (그리고 꽤 많이 멀티 캐스트를 사용하는 반면) 멀티 캐스트는 인수로 제공된 주제를 사용합니다.

관련 문제